Job Purpose:
The Chief Executive’s Office incorporates various functions such as policy, performance, MP/customer/elected member/Government department liaison, liaison with external bodies / partners, coordination of management information. The Executive Support Officer is a part of this team providing high-level executive support to the Chief Executive’s Office to ensure the efficient and effective running of the leadership function at Ryedale District Council. The post holder will be responsible for supporting and contributing to the delivery of the objectives of the Strategic Management Board, through provision of a proactive, high-level executive support service. The post-holders will be the key point of contact for the Chief Executive Officer and Strategic Management Board, proactively managing internal/external enquires and communication, most of which will be of a sensitive and/or confidential nature, using personal judgement and sound decision-making.
Accountabilities:
- Proactively preparing and managing the correspondence for the Chief Executive and members of the Strategic Management Board (SMB), reading, researching and routing as needed. Prepare correspondence on behalf of the Chief Executive and members of Strategic Management Board to both internal and external stakeholders and draft, produce and sign correspondence when necessary.
- Organising and managing SMB members diaries including organising meetings and activities, with a full range of senior stakeholders both internal and external to the Council, liaising effectively with colleagues across the organisation, ensuring high regard for excellent customer service both internally and externally.
- Briefing senior leaders and writing meeting minutes including making accurate records and agreed actions and be responsible for distributing in a timely manner.
- Carrying out a wide range of research and policy development activity as may be required to include preparing reports and making recommendations.
- Support the drafting of a range of materials such as presentations, papers for meetings and reports, including gathering data and researching material to provide recommendations where appropriate.
- Undertake specific projects as directed, some of which may be sensitive and confidential nature. Provide ad-hoc support as required, such as conducting research, gathering data and presenting findings in a timely manner.
- Correspond and co-ordinate activities with a full range of Senior Stakeholders both internal and external to the Council, using diplomacy and discretion.
- Organise and prioritise work efficiently to ensure smooth running of the office on a day-to-day basis, including identifying opportunities to improve administrative procedures and taking the initiative to suggest ways of working more efficiently.
- Budget responsibilities: compilation and submission of receipts and expense claims.
- Risk Management: Paying due regard to reputational risk in errors of organisation, administration and confidentiality and mitigating appropriately.
- Accurate file management, including use of relevant office and electronic systems to ensure the efficient running of the executive function.
- Ensuring that duties are carried out with full regard to the Council’s policies, including Equal Opportunities, Health and Safety and Information Governance.
